About Saint Usuge Spaniel
The Saint Usuge Spaniel is a rare French brown roan gundog, medium-sized with a soft wavy coat and gentle eyes. Calm, affectionate, and people-oriented at home, it is energetic in the field, working closely with hunters and excelling at scenting, pointing, and retrieving on land and in water.
About Papillon
The Papillon is a small, elegant toy dog with large butterfly-like ears, a fine, silky parti-coloured coat and a plumed tail. Lively, intelligent and highly trainable, it enjoys activity and mental stimulation, makes an alert watchdog, needs regular brushing, and often lives into the mid–late teens.
